What Are Live Resin Gummies?
At a glance, live resin gummies might look like your typical chewy cannabis edibles, but there’s a lot more going on under the hood.
Live Resin Production
Live resin is a type of cannabis concentrate made differently than most others. Instead of drying and curing the plants after harvest (which is the usual process), growers flash-freeze the plants right away. That might sound high-tech, but the idea is pretty straightforward: freezing the plants keeps all those precious cannabinoids and terpenes locked in from the jump.
Preservation of Cannabinoids and Terpenes
Because the plants are frozen fresh, nothing valuable cooks off or breaks down. You’re left with a concentrate that keeps a ton of that original plant flavor, aroma, and potency. When that concentrate is infused into gummies, you’re basically getting a compact package loaded with more of the good stuff—sometimes called the “full-spectrum” effect.
Difference from Distillate
Many edibles on the market use distillate, which focuses mainly on THC but strips out most of the other compounds. Live resin gummies are a whole different ballgame—they contain a combination of cannabinoids and terpenes that work better together. That means you’re not just getting high—you’re feeling the effects in a more balanced, consistent, and flavorful way.

How Do Live Resin Gummies Work?
Gummies don’t hit like a vape or pre-roll. There’s a specific process your body goes through, so here’s the rundown.
Absorption Process
When you eat a gummy, it gets digested like food. From there, the cannabinoids head to your liver, where they get transformed into a more potent version. That version enters your bloodstream and starts doing its thing.
Onset Time and Duration
Since digestion takes a minute, effects can take anywhere from 45 to 90 minutes to start. Don’t rush it—this is totally normal. Once they kick in, expect a slow and steady ride that peaks around the 90-120 minute mark. Depending on your metabolism and tolerance, effects can last for several hours.

Live Resin vs. Live Rosin Gummies
Both sound fancy, but they’re made differently. Live resin comes from hydrocarbons like butane during extraction, while live rosin is solventless and just uses heat and pressure. People say rosin offers a slightly cleaner high, but resin tends to pack more flavor and potency. It comes down to preference.
